The Cleaning Ladydirector Catriona McKenzie has explained Arman’s death in season 3 of the show, including how it paid tribute to the death of his actor, Adan Canto, who died in early 2024. Canto had portrayed the Los Angeles gangster since the series began, but was absent throughoutThe Cleaning Ladyseason 3’s story. That was until episode 6, when he sacrificed himself to save Thony from one of the people who’d previously captured him, resulting in the car he was in driving off a bridge. His final, noble action was saving the show’s main protagonist.
Speaking withScreen Rant, McKenzie explained why Arman’s death inThe Cleaning Ladyseason 3 happened the way it did, as well as how it honors Canto’s time on the series. The director revealed howthe moment cemented his character as a hero, acting as a positive sendoff despite the tragic circumstances. Check out what McKenzie had to say below:

One of the things that I’m good at is I’m really good at leading with a sense of compassion. As a director, you fall into the engine that is a show in its third season show. It’s an engine that is up and running, and it’s a very tight-knit crew and a crew that are grieving.
I’m good at doing action, and I knew they wanted to really honor Adan’s life and give his character a good sendoff. He sacrifices himself as a hero, so we did the Thelma and Louise thing and sent him off the cliff. It was quite a technical thing to do, but everyone obviously wanted to give him that moment. It was very sad for everyone — and particularly Elodie [Yung], who had to do that scene on the cliff’s edge. It was devastating for her, but she’s such a professional.

I guess it’s about being very calm and very precise and very gentle. I do think that, when you’re directing, you have to remember that actors are not machines. They’re living, breathing human beings with a life and feelings and insecurities. I just think kindness is key. To be kind to another human that has to step in and do the work is civilized and gracious.
How Arman’s Absence Will Impact The Cleaning Lady Season 4
Following Arman’s sacrifice, the episode cuts to when he and Thony slow-danced and kissed in Mexico, all the way back in season 1.The episode is then dedicated to Canto, who died of appendiceal cancer back in January 2024. The emotional resonance of the scene not only hits because of how important his character was to the show, but also because of the actor’s death. It makes his character’s sacrifice all the more memorable, as it will be the last time he’s seen onscreen.
Arman’s death had a major impact on Thony for the rest of season 3, even as the story threads began to converge on different elements of the show. Given Canto’s death at the start of 2024,the actor’s absence had already been felt throughout the latest episodes.Going intoThe Cleaning Ladyseason 4, however, there will be a more empty space for his character than there ever was before. This means the next episodes will likely see the protagonist continue trying to process how he sacrificed himself to save her.

The Cleaning Lady is a drama series centered on Thony De La Rosa, a Cambodian doctor who becomes an undocumented immigrant in the United States. Forced to work as a cleaning lady, she navigates complicated situations while using her medical expertise. The series explores themes of survival, resilience, and the lengths one goes to protect their family. Starring Elodie Yung, the show delves into the hidden struggles of those living on the margins of society.
